Finnish powerhouse Junk52 has decided to pick up a COD4 team. Junk52, a name once renowned in the Call of Duty scene, has decided to return to action with an all Dutch lineup consisting of some experienced players such as Nielsson and Kleineman, as well as some relatively new and fresh faces like flexoR and 7ommie. The backbone of the team will come from the combination of Nielsson and Kleineman, both ex-members of Rubberduckies, who had a small amount of success in the latest version of the EuroCup. Supporting them will be four relatively unknown Dutch players meaning that this will be a six man lineup, which seems to be following a relatively new trend of having six players to battle inactivity, a method popularized by Speedlink not so long ago. The third player in the lineup is Kryon, who will be acting as team leader and trying to use his experience in the original Call of Duty to push the team forward. The remaining three are flexoR, 7ommie and manko, who will be doing their best to make a name for themselves in Call of Duty 4. These six players will now be playing under the Junk52 flag in Call of Duty 4. Kleinemann Onielsson Kryon flexoR 7ommie mankoTeam captain Kryon introduced the team in a brief statement. "We are happy to join Junk52 Theatre, they have been a great help in our start for Call of Duty 4 and we look forward to upcoming events. Junk52 has always been a great multigaming clan with good support and teams, therefore we choose to join the organisation as their Call of Duty 4 squad. We look forward to working together with them." |
